发明名称 Processor extensions for execution of secure embedded containers
摘要 Methods and apparatus relating to processor extensions for execution of secure embedded containers are described. In an embodiment, a scalable solution for manageability function is provided, e.g., for UMPC environments or otherwise where utilizing a dedicated processor or microcontroller for manageability is inappropriate or impractical. For example, in an embodiment, an OS (Operating System) or VMM (Virtual Machine Manager) Independent (generally referred to herein as “OI”) architecture involves creating one or more containers on a processor by dynamically partitioning resources (such as processor cycles, memory, devices) between the HOST OS/VMM and the OI container. Other embodiments are also described and claimed.
申请公布号 US9086913(B2) 申请公布日期 2015.07.21
申请号 US200812347890 申请日期 2008.12.31
申请人 Intel Corporation 发明人 Shanbhogue Vedvyas;Kumar Arvind;Goel Purushottam
分类号 G06F9/46;G06F9/48;G06F9/50;G06F9/455 主分类号 G06F9/46
代理机构 Mnemoglyphics, LLC 代理人 Mnemoglyphics, LLC ;Mennemeier Lawrence M.
主权项 1. An apparatus comprising: a storage unit having a plurality of partitions, wherein a first partition from the plurality of partitions is to store an Operating System (OS) independent partition, having an execution environment that is independent of, and unaffected by operating systems and virtual machine managers, and a second partition from the plurality of partitions is to store an OS; and an OS Independent (OI) Resource Manager (OIRM) to couple the plurality of partitions to a processor, wherein the OIRM is to dynamically partition cycles of the processor between the first partition and the second partition, and wherein an application running on the processor from the second partition can obtain a key blob from the OIRM to access data in the first partition.
地址 Santa Clara CA US